## Changelog — Font vendoring defaults changed

As of this release, the Bracken UI build no longer fetches third-party fonts at build time. All typefaces used by the Lanternwell suite are now vendored into the repo under a dedicated assets directory, and the fetch step is skipped by default. If you're onboarding, nothing to install — the fonts travel with the checkout. The build flags controlling this behavior are listed below.

settings of hadup-yafog:
LAMAEL_PIN=3761
LAMAEL_TENANT=istmir
LAMAEL_METRICS_HOST=metrics.lamael.plorvasys.test
LAMAEL_SEAL=seal_8ea68500
LAMAEL_STANDBY_TEAM=fraok

**Step 5 — Frostwake handlers.** Verify the Frostwake cold-start warmer keys were destroyed before rotation. New members: no warm pool may run during the ceremony. Confirm all serverless handlers report cold state in the Tinmoor dashboard, then seal the new keyset. The sealing tool prompts for the recovery passphrase given below.

recovery phrase for tawef-hawif: praiel-novvan-frador-soriel-novath-pelath

Ticket: Staging env misconfigured for Siftgate bloom filter

The bloom layer in front of the Pellet KV store is rejecting all lookups in staging because the env file was copied from the dev template without credentials. False-positive tuning values are fine; only the auth line is missing. To unblock the weekly demo, the Pellet admission secret must be set on the following line.

env line for yaguf-fajop: LEDGER_TOKEN13=fb08984397349

Runbook: Planner Regression Mitigation — Quillbase 4.2

After the upgrade, the Quillbase planner began choosing nested-loop joins on the orders_flat table, inflating p99 latency. Reviewers should confirm the pinned plan hints in planner_overrides.sql before approving. To enable the override service, the staging env file needs the planner hint flag plus the service credential. Add the following line to staging.env immediately after the hint flag.

env line for fafof-fahag: LEDGER_TOKEN5=f8790